Why Calculating Aquarium Capacity Matters
Many beginners make the error of counting on the producer's small size (e.g., purchasing a "50-gallon tank" and presuming it holds 50 gallons of water). In truth, determining the precise capability is crucial for a number of factors:
Stocking Limits: The classic "one inch of Fish Tank Volume Calculator per gallon" guideline counts on accurate volume. Overstocking leads to bad water quality and worried fish.Medication Dosing: Under-dosing medication will stop working to treat diseases, while over-dosing can be hazardous and deadly to aquatic life.Water Treatments: Dechlorinators, fertilizers, and pH adjusters should be measured against the specific volume of water in the system.Equipment Sizing: Heaters and filters are rated by gallon capability. An inaccurate computation can result in inadequate purification or temperature changes.The Standard Formulas for Tank Shapes
Most aquariums are geometric shapes. By measuring the within measurements of the tank (length, width, and height) in inches, fish keepers can calculate Aquarium capacity the volume in cubic inches and convert it into gallons or liters.
1. Rectangle-shaped Aquariums
The most typical tank shape is the rectangular prism.
Formula: ₤ \ text Volume (gallons) = \ frac \ text Length \ times \ text Width \ times \ text Height 231 ₤Why 231? There are 231 cubic inches in a basic U.S. liquid gallon.2. Round Aquariums
Column or round tanks are popular for their 360-degree watching angles, but their volume requires the formula for the volume of a cylinder.
Formula: ₤ \ text Volume (gallons) = \ frac \ pi \ times r ^ 2 \ times \ text Height 231 ₤( Note: ₤ r ₤ is the radius, which is half of the cylinder's diameter).3. Bow-Front Aquariums
Bow-front tanks have a curved front glass that increases the volume somewhat compared to a basic rectangle-shaped tank of the exact same footprint.
Formula: ₤ \ text Volume (gallons) = \ frac (\ text Flat Width + \ text Max Width) \ div 2 \ times \ text Length \ times \ text Height 231 ₤Quick Reference Conversion Table

One of the most common pitfalls in the aquarium pastime is confusing tank capacity with real water volume.

When a tank is filled, several aspects take up physical space inside the glass, displacing water. Therefore, a tank ranked for 50 gallons will seldom hold a complete 50 gallons of water.
Factors That Reduce Actual Water Volume:Substrate: Gravel, sand, and aqusoil layers can use up anywhere from 5% to 15% of the total tank volume.Hardscape: Large rocks, driftwood, and ceramic decors displace substantial quantities of water.Devices: Internal filters, heating systems, and air stones minimize the liquid capacity.Unfavorable Space: Most enthusiasts do not fill their tanks to the absolute brim; a standard safety margin leaves about 1 to 2 inches of area at the top.
As a general guideline, deduct 10% to 15% from the computed geometric volume to discover the true water volume of a heavily embellished tank.
Step-by-Step Guide to Calculating Actual Water Volume
For those who wish to be 100% accurate, follow this step-by-step technique throughout the preliminary fill-up:
Measure the Empty Tank: Measure the interior length, width, and height in inches and utilize the formula to find the maximum possible capacity.Represent the Substrate and Hardscape: Once the substrate and designs are in place, determine the height of the water line from the bottom of the tank (instead of the overall height of the glass).Use the Water Line Calculation: Recalculate using the water height instead of the glass height:₤ ₤ \ text Real Volume = \ frac \ text Length \ times \ text Width \ times \ text Water Height 231 ₤ ₤The Bucket Method (Alternative): For irregularly shaped tanks, the most accurate approach is to fill the tank using a marked container (like a 1-gallon or 5-gallon pail), keeping a rigorous count of the number of gallons are gathered up until it reaches the desired level.Essential Tips for Success
To guarantee accuracy and safety when dealing with aquarium capabilities, keep these best practices in mind:
Always procedure from the within: Measuring the outside of the glass consists of the density of the glass panels, which can throw off the calculation by a gallon or more on bigger tanks.Convert Metric easily: If working in centimeters, utilize the metric formula (₤ \ text Length \ times \ text Width \ times \ text Height in cm \ div 1000 = \ text Liters ₤). To transform liters to U.S. gallons, divide the overall liters by 3.785.Never max out stocking limits: Always base your stocking choices on the lower end of your real water volume calculation to provide a buffer for your Fish Aquarium Calculator.
